Ever seen a new building going up in your neighborhood, and wondered "how did that get there?" Meet the people behind the magic of Boston's biggest housing boom ever. Staff members of the Boston Planning & Development Agency (BPDA) will join the SPARK Boston Council in South Boston for the first (of hopefully many) mixers. Learn more about the BPDA's many functions as a quasi-government agency in a low pressure environment with snacks and friends. We call it: Pint with a Planner!

The BPDA will be providing the food courtesy of Roza Lyons, but we need you to bring your questions about community engagement, programming, and Boston's housing market. There's no formal agenda. This is an opportunity to share an evening (and should you choose to purchase one, a drink) with the City's planning, workforce development, and real estate team, as well as other young professionals from the neighborhood. Our arts and crafts workshops are led by local artists. They're held Tuesday through Friday in July and August and run from 10 a.m. until 12 p.m. These drop-in workshops encourage kids to explore their creativity through projects like mask making, crayon art, watercolor and much more. Supplies are provided, but you'll need to bring your creativity! 

This series is completely free and open to Boston residents. These workshops will take place in various parks throughout the City of Boston.
